Amelanotic melanoma.

Hui-Zi Gong, He-Yi Zheng, Jun Li

    Melanoma Research
    |January 24, 2019
    PubMed
    Summary
    This summary is machine-generated.

    Amelanotic melanoma (AM) is a rare melanoma subtype lacking pigment, posing diagnostic challenges. These melanomas often present with aggressive features and poorer prognoses compared to pigmented melanomas.

    Area of Science:

    • Dermatology
    • Oncology

    Background:

    • Cutaneous amelanotic melanoma (AM) is a rare subtype of melanoma, accounting for 0.4-27.5% of all cases.
    • AM predominantly affects individuals over 50, with a variable male-to-female ratio.
    • Risk factors include red hair, fair skin (Type I), freckles, few nevi, sun sensitivity, and prior AM history.

    Purpose of the Study:

    • To summarize the characteristics and clinical presentation of amelanotic melanoma.
    • To highlight the diagnostic challenges posed by AM due to its varied appearance.
    • To compare the clinicopathological features and outcomes of AM with pigmented melanomas.

    Main Methods:

    • Review of existing literature on cutaneous amelanotic melanoma.
    • Analysis of epidemiological data, risk factors, and clinical presentation.

  • Comparison of histopathological features and survival rates between AM and pigmented melanoma.
  • Main Results:

    • AM lacks pigmentation, leading to diverse appearances that can mimic other conditions, complicating diagnosis.
    • AM subtypes include higher proportions of nodular, acral lentiginous, and desmoplastic melanoma.
    • Compared to pigmented melanomas, AMs exhibit greater Breslow thickness, higher mitotic rates, more frequent ulceration, advanced tumor stage, and reduced survival.

    Conclusions:

    • Amelanotic melanoma presents unique diagnostic and therapeutic challenges due to its varied presentation and aggressive nature.
    • Early recognition and accurate diagnosis are crucial for improving outcomes in AM patients.
    • Further research is needed to improve diagnostic accuracy and treatment strategies for this rare melanoma subtype.
